Contingency Fees

If you select a mesothelioma law firm the lawyer you choose will work on a contingency fee basis. This means that you only pay if your lawyer wins your case. The typical client is responsible for court and client fees, however this should be stated in your contract for hiring.

Time Limits

Asbestos-related victims can make a claim or lawsuit for compensation under various statutes of limitations. These deadlines vary according to the type of claim, and where the exposure occurred. Mesothelioma lawyers understand the intricacies and exceptions surrounding these statutes. They can look over the time limits for each asbestos case in order to determine the best strategy.

Typically, the statute of limitations starts counting down from the date an asbestos victim was diagnosed with mesothelioma or another asbestos-related disease. It is difficult to pinpoint exactly when asbestos exposure occurred due to the long mesothelioma latency. Mesothelioma victims and their families have to engage with mesothelioma lawyers who understand the laws governing mesothelioma as well as the long mesothelioma litigation process.

The time limit for personal injury and wrongful death claims varies by state. In most instances, they vary from 1 year to 6 years after the diagnosis of an asbestos-related illness or the death of a loved one. Many factors can affect the time limit, such as the place where asbestos exposure took place, the specific asbestos-related company responsible for exposure, and the type of m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related illness.
